9mol% Magnesia Partially Stabilized Zirconia (Mg-PSZ) |
Characteristics |
Item |
Value |
Unit |
Mechanical Characteristics |
Colour |
Yellow |
Density |
5.7 |
g/cm3 |
Bending Strength |
500 |
MPa |
Compressive Strength |
2,500 |
MPa |
Elastic Modulus |
250 |
GPa |
Fracture Toughness |
6~7 |
MPam1/2 |
Weber Coefficient |
12 |
M |
Vickers Hardness |
1,100 |
HV0.5 |
Thermal Characteristics |
Coefficient of Line Thermal Expansion |
10 |
10-6K-1 |
Thermal Conductivity |
3 |
W/mK |
Thermal Shock Resistance (Put in Water) |
450 |
?T°C |
Max Working Temperature |
2,100 |
°C |
Electrical Characteristics |
Volume Resistance at 20°C |
>1014 |
?cm |
Dielectric Strength |
13×105 |
V/m |
Dielectric Constant |
28 |
εr |
One MHZ Dielectric Loss Angle at 20°C |
0.0017 |
tanδ |
Chemical Characteristics |
Nitric Acid (60%) 90°C |
0.1 |
WTLossmg/cm2/day |
Sulphuric Acid (95%) 95°C |
0.34 |
Caustic Soda (30%) 80°C |
0.95 |
The chart is intended to illustrate typical properties of Mg-PSZ ceramic. Engineering data is representative. Property values vary somewhat with method of manufacture, size, and shape of part. |
